Produktbeschreibung
Inanna lives an idyllic life with her parents in a small house by the sea, but while she's away in the City a tiny dragon sneaks into their garden & bewitches them. At the behest of a peculiarly wise heron, Inanna sets out on an arduous trek fraught with hazards to find the dragon and restore her parents to life. Aided in her quest by an unlikely collection of allies-- a wild hyena, an old trader, three Old-world Goddesses, and a witch-- the girl prepares to meet her dragon through a series of encounters with a highwayman, an ambitious prince, and a mysterious & dangerous wizard. Her final confrontation, with a dragon now grown immense & powerful, is not what she expects. Using the ancient Sumerian Gilgamesh epic as a scaffolding for this feminst tale of heroism & courage, Fearless Inanna features twelve original illustrations, a map, and more than twenty pages of glossary for the more difficult vocabulary words for young readers.
Autorenporträt
An award-winning artist, author, & filmmaker, Jonathan Schork was born and raised in the Catskill Mountains of New York State, and spent several decades of his adult life in a solar house on the end of an island in the Florida Keys (where he developed and patented several alternative energy systems electronic devices). With a relentless curiosity and a determined ethos of community service, Schork includes among his interests Balinese Gamelan Music, history, public education, science, community activism, cuisine, & couture. He is a past board member of several not-for-profit corporations, and currently sits on the board of directors of a small Tampa Bay area arts & entertainment 501(c)3. Widowed in 2006 after 25 years of marriage to his high school English teacher, he resides today in a partially renovated, condemned house in St.Petersburg, Florida, with his mother, his girlfriend, and his semi-tame, stray cat. More Tales is his sixth book.
